Radar speed signs are electronic devices that combine radar technology and LED displays to detect the speed of moving vehicles...
The core technology of radar speed sign is based on the Doppler effect, which is the principle of using radio waves to measure the speed of object movement...
Some of the radar speed measuring devices can be installed on traffic enforcement vehicles to detect the speed of oncoming vehicles at any time...
In the vicinity of schools or residential areas, speeding may lead to serious traffic accidents...
Roads around hospitals need to be kept at low speeds to minimize noise nuisance and ensure the smooth flow of emergency vehicles...
On highways, radar speed signs can be used to remind drivers to adjust their speed in bad weather or heavy traffic...
Construction sections usually require temporary speed reduction to protect the safety of construction workers and drivers...
Research data show that after the installation of radar speed signs, about 80% of the speeding driving behavior has been improved...
Traditional speed limit signs are often easily ignored, while radar speed signs enable drivers to instantly notice their own speed...
By effectively reminding drivers to control their speed, radar speed signs can reduce the rate of accidents caused by speeding...
Reasonable speed control helps to ease traffic congestion, reduce traffic chaos caused by sudden braking or speeding...
